Webber College - Admission Criteria Criteria Ranking |
High School GPA and Class Rank | Standardized Tests
Criteria Ranking
- Academic ranking criteria for this college is listed below. Academic criteria are ranked in order of importance from 1 (Most important) through 5 (Least important) or N (Not relevant).
| Rank | Criterion |
| 1 | Secondary School Record |
| 5 | Class Rank |
| 3 | School's Recommendation |
| 2 | Standardized Test Scores |
| 4 | Essay |
- The following non-academic criteria are indicated as E (Emphasized), I (Important), C Considered, or N (Not relevant).
| Rank | Criterion |
| E | Character and Personality |
| C | Extracurricular participation |
| N | Particular talent or ability |
| N | Geographical distribution |
| C | Alumni/ae relationship |
High School GPA and Class Rank for 1994
- The average high school/secondary school Grade Point Average for
freshmen stood at 2.7.
- Following is a breakdown of the high school class rank of enrolled freshmen.
| Rank | Percent |
| Top fifth | 9% |
| Second fifth | 40% |
| Third fifth | 44% |
| Fourth fifth | 6% |
| Bottom fifth | 1% |
Standardized Test Score Criteria
- Scores reported below include some using the old scoring system which have been recentered.
- 42% of accepted applicants submitted an SAT I score and 33% of accepted applicants submitted an ACT score.
- Here are the scores of enrolled freshmen who took
the SAT I:
SAT verbal scores over 500 16%, ACT scores over 18 55%, SAT verbal scores over 600 1%, ACT scores over 24 6%, SAT verbal scores over 700 0%, SAT math scores over 700 1%, ACT scores over 30 0%
